Hertz Introduces Tesla Roadster Electric Vehicles Into Fleet at Show Biz Expo on May 7th

Hertz continues to expand its electric vehicle fleet and offers premium model for test-drives at five-star production tradeshow and conference.

by Staff
May 6, 2011
2 min to read


PARK RIDGE, NJ -- (MARKET WIRE) -- 05/05/2011 -- The Hertz Corporation announced that it will introduce Tesla Roadsters, the electric supercar, into the Hertz Global EV fleet as part of Hertz Entertainment Services at the Show Biz Expo on Saturday, May 7, 2011. Hertz Entertainment Services will exhibit at the Show Biz Expo in the West Hall, Booth #420, which includes a Tesla ride-and-drive located nearby on Gilbert Lindsay Drive. Hertz will place two Tesla Roadsters in Los Angeles, California that will be available to rent by Entertainment Services customers immediately.

Offering up to 295 lbs-ft of torque and 288 horsepower, the Tesla Roadster smoothly can accelerate from 0 to 60 mph in 3.7 seconds without a drop of gasoline. Engineered for efficiency, the zero-emission electric vehicle can drive 245 miles per charge. It plugs into nearly any outlet.

Show Biz Expo is a professional five-star tradeshow and conference that brings all aspects of film/video, television, theatre and event production together under one roof. People attend Show Biz Expo to network with peers and make new contacts; learn about new products & services; attend workshops and film screenings.

Hertz Entertainment Services provides single-source car and equipment rental solutions to the entertainment and special events industries. Hertz Entertainment Services provides customized vehicle and equipment rental solutions to movie, film and television productions, live sports and entertainment events, and all-occasion special events, such as weddings, conventions, and fairs.

Hertz Entertainment Services are tailored to fit the needs of large and small productions alike with competitive pricing and customized, monthly billing. Hertz delivers vehicles and equipment to production locations and a dedicated staff is available 24/7 to address specific client needs. Productions can also rent equipment for use at special events such as lighting, generators and other machinery.

Hertz's experience and willingness to pick up and deliver hybrid and specialized vehicles, such as the Toyota Prius, the BMW Mini Cooper, the Ford Escape Hybrid, and the Lincoln Navigator sets it apart from the competition. The Hertz Prestige Collection is especially popular with actors, while crews benefit from larger vehicles such as minivans, 15 Passenger Vans and SUVs and enjoy having access to a wide array of lighting solutions, generators, lifts and water trucks.
